Output ddc7582eacf1519b65adaa30145d3bcc7eff315f461dfb8cd48ce9432d03dcd2:1

value
21314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 065951e64fc54c2d3ba386f9d59a24f0c1029668 OP_EQUALVERIFY OP_CHECKSIG
address
1aa4D4F1hjFqZRAsmG81bA5naZyGWQqug
transaction
ddc7582eacf1519b65adaa30145d3bcc7eff315f461dfb8cd48ce9432d03dcd2
confirmations
248502
spent
true